Had lunch here a few weeks back. Been wanting to have steak for a while and was looking forward to this because the reviews seemed very encouraging.
Overall, it wasn’t bad but there are other better options at this price point if you’re willing to travel to Hartamas or TTDI, in my humble opinion. Even more so when i found out why there are so many 5 star reviews. You get a free scoop of ice cream if you leave a 5 star google review 🤣
Let’s start with the good stuff. Service was fantastic, the staff were very friendly and very helpful. They explained the different cuts of meats very well and they constantly checked up on us to make sure everything was fine.
Now onto the food, it wasn’t bad but for the price you’re paying, i really was expecting better. It starts off at RM79 i think for the 150g cut but that’s a bit too small for me. For 300g, prices range from RM139-RM300+ (if i can recall correctly), and this is for Australian meat. I didn’t bother with the Wagyu stuff because I was never going to spend that much to begin with. Went for the strip loin and it wasn’t bad by any stretch of the imagination but it lacked flavour and wasn’t very tender. The sides were somewhat flat as well; the roasted veggies were bland, fries were good but the portion wasn’t great. Couldn’t fault the grilled pineapples though haha. The steak DID NOT satisfy my cravings at all as I left feeling wanting.
